Acid and Alkali Resistant Pressure Sensor Market

Acid and alkali resistant pressure sensors are specialized transducers engineered to deliver accurate pressure measurements in highly corrosive environments, employing robust housing technologies such as ceramic or silicon cores that endure aggressive acidic or alkaline media. Increased Use of Next-generation Sequencing to Drive Use of DNA Modifying Enzymes

Next-Generation Sequencing (NGS) is revolutionizing genomics research by enabling the sequencing of millions of DNA fragments simultaneously. This technology provides comprehensive insights into genome structure, genetic variations, gene expression, and gene behavior, driving advancements in personalized healthcare and disease understanding. Recent advances in NGS focus on faster, more accurate sequencing, reduced costs, and enhanced data analysis, which are crucial for revealing new genomic insights and developing targeted therapies. Additionally, innovations in biopharmaceuticals and high‑fidelity product launches are expected to drive NGS and the use of these enzymes. For instance, in November 2023, New England Biolabs (NEB) launched the NEBNext UltraExpress DNA and RNA Library Prep Kits for next‑generation sequencing on the Illumina platform. Such advancements are expected to fuel the market growth.

Growing Demand for Personalized Medicine to Boost Market Growth

The growing demand for personalized medicine is poised to boost the market significantly. Personalized medicine, which involves tailoring treatments to individual genetic profiles, is experiencing rapid growth due to advancements in genomic technologies such as NGS and other molecular techniques. This approach allows for more effective and targeted therapies, particularly in oncology, where NGS helps identify specific mutations for tailored treatments. As the personalized medicine market expands, driven by factors such as increased cancer prevalence and technological advancements, the demand for DNA‑modifying enzymes rises. These enzymes are crucial for genetic testing and therapy, making them essential components in the development of personalized treatments.

Moreover, initiatives undertaken by the regulatory bodies for personalized medicine are expected to fuel the market growth.

For instance,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is working to ensure the accuracy of NGS tests so that patients and clinicians can receive accurate and clinically meaningful test results.

Technical Complications and Shortage of Skilled Professionals to Deter Market Growth

DNA‑modifying enzymes in biotechnology and genetic engineering offer innovative opportunities. However, there are several challenges associated with its integration. One major issue is off‑target effects, where enzymes modify unintended genomic sites, potentially leading to harmful consequences and raising safety concerns. This can create regulatory hurdles, making companies hesitant to invest in these technologies.

Additionally, designing precise delivery systems and scaling up enzyme production while maintaining quality is a significant challenge. The biotechnology industry's rapid growth requires a skilled workforce; however, a shortage of qualified professionals, exacerbated by retirements, further complicates market adoption. These factors collectively limit the market growth of DNA‑modifying enzymes.
